Rasterman (nprofile…paqn) Christi Junior (nprofile…d6d2) >weak, slow, meme controller, forgettable games
Mario 64 basically revolutionized 3D platform games
Goldeneye 007 was basically Deus Ex three years before Deus Ex released
Super Smash Bros and Mario Party were peak multiplayer fun
Both Zelda games were also revolutionary at their time in terms of adventure games
All of those games were greatly influential to games that came after, and I can say without any doubt that the game landscape wouldn't be the same without the N64.
The only thing I get salty about is that while Nintendo released a flawed system with some neat ideas (because yes, the N64 was a flawed system) and it was still a success and kept the company going, Sega released an awesome but flawed system with some very neat ideas and it wasn't a success and spelt the end of Sega as a console maker and then Microsoft wore it's corpse in a crude and disrespectful mockery of it.
